    Abstract

    Distributed Integrated Modular Avionics(DIMA)system has become the development direction of the next generation of avionics systems.In order to determine the network communication technology of the DIMA system, we built the system architecture model and discussed its difference and connection with the federated system and Integrated Modular Avionics (IMA) system on the Communication, Navigation and Identification (CNI) integrated system.On this basis, the network communication requirements of the DIMA system was summarized.The advantages of using Time-Triggered Ethernet (TTE) to realize DIMA system network interconnection in real-time and reliable communication as well as system incremental upgrade were verified by comparing and analyzing Fiber Channel (FC) and avionics full duplex switched ethernet with TTE.
